Thursday 3rd
April 17
My dearest Your letter containing “Barrage” has just come to hand I was very interested in it. It is not in the least little bit like it but very interesting and very good. LS & Baker say it is a very good and wonderfully clever idea of it without ever having seen it. I do not think it gives any idea of it at all myself. I gave you all the wrong lines I see now. You see as viewed from a position the whole thing takes place in a background of dawning sky and any foreground you do should be a foreground of a ridge much closer to the trenches (to the observer) so the trenches shouldnt be really there at all. Your picture now is a little study of a certain piece of ground. Well it isnt right at all. You should have a nonentity foreground then over the ridge of it & beyond against the dawning sky a great appeal for artillery support is seen. I dont know why the idea is intriguing me so much but it has got hold of me properly. I dont believe that the idea that is in my head is possible to paint.
